Understanding Live Traffic Data

So, how does this magic work, you ask? Live traffic data is collected from a variety of sources, all working together to give you the most up-to-the-minute picture of road conditions. Think of it like a giant, interconnected brain for our roads. One of the primary sources is GPS data from smartphones and navigation devices. When millions of devices are moving, their speed and location data can be aggregated anonymously to understand traffic flow. If a lot of phones are moving slowly in a particular area, it’s a pretty good indicator of a jam. Another key player is road sensors embedded in the pavement. These sensors can detect vehicle presence, speed, and density, feeding information directly to traffic management centers. You also have data coming from connected cars – newer vehicles equipped with sensors and communication technology can share information about their surroundings, including traffic conditions and even potential hazards. Finally, traffic cameras, though not always providing automated data, are crucial for human operators to monitor situations and provide qualitative information. All these streams of data are processed rapidly, often using sophisticated algorithms and AI, to paint a clear, real-time map of what's happening on the roads. This constant flow of information allows apps and services to update your route dynamically, rerouting you away from unexpected delays and helping you avoid those dreaded live traffic jams near me.

How to Find Live Traffic Jams Near You

Now, let's get to the good stuff: how do you actually find these live traffic jams near me? The easiest and most common way is by using navigation apps on your smartphone. Apps like Google Maps, Waze, and Apple Maps are your best friends when it comes to real-time traffic. They use the data we just talked about to show you color-coded traffic levels on your map – green for clear, orange for moderate delays, and red or dark red for heavy congestion or complete standstill. Many of these apps also offer real-time traffic alerts for your planned route, notifying you of jams ahead and suggesting faster alternatives. For example, Waze is particularly well-known for its community-driven alerts, where users can report accidents, police presence, road hazards, and yes, even traffic jams. This crowdsourced information adds another layer of real-time detail that’s incredibly valuable. Beyond these popular apps, some local transportation authorities and Department of Transportation (DOT) websites offer their own live traffic maps. These can be excellent resources, especially if you're looking for information on specific highways or major arterial roads in your area. They often provide camera feeds and detailed incident reports. The Future of Traffic Management

Looking ahead, the landscape of live traffic jam prediction and management is set to become even more sophisticated, guys. We're moving beyond just reacting to current conditions towards a future where traffic flow is proactively managed and optimized. One of the biggest advancements on the horizon is the integ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) on a massive scale. These technologies can analyze vast amounts of historical and real-time data to predict traffic patterns with uncanny accuracy. Imagine an AI system that not only knows there's a jam now but can predict with high confidence that a certain intersection will experience congestion in 30 minutes based on weather, upcoming events, and current traffic velocity. This predictive capability will allow traffic management systems to dynamically adjust traffic light timings, implement variable speed limits, and even reroute traffic before significant jams form. Connected and autonomous vehicles (CAVs) will also play a pivotal role. As more cars become capable of communicating with each other and with infrastructure (V2X communication), they can form a dense network of real-time data collectors and communicators. CAVs can share information about braking events, road conditions, and their intended paths, allowing for smoother traffic flow and immediate hazard warnings. This interconnectedness could drastically reduce the need for human intervention in managing traffic. Furthermore, the concept of smart cities is intrinsically linked to the future of traffic management. Integrated city-wide systems will use data from various sources – not just vehicles, but also public transport, pedestrian movement, and even environmental sensors – to create a holistic understanding of urban mobility. This allows for optimized public transportation schedules, better coordination of road maintenance, and more efficient emergency response. We might also see the expansion of on-demand mobility services that can adapt in real-time to traffic conditions, offering personalized and efficient travel solutions.
